> > > > > Hi Richard,
> >
> > > > > I am not convinced this is a good solution. The reason is that two
> > > > > processes perform insert at the same that may not return the ID of
> > > > > previous insert but the last one, therefore the same value. I may
> be
> > > > > wrong.
> >
> > > > > I have just added to trunk another solution:
> >
> > > > >  db.define_table(....,sequence_name='table_pk_Seq')
> >
> > > > > so that you can specify your sequence name.  This is compatible to
> > > > > what we do for other databases. Please check it and see if it works
> > > > > for you.
> >
> > > > > Massimo
